2020 was a year filled with challenges and opportunities. To not only rise to those challenges, but to innovate and excel. This is an organization of top performers. Today, we recognize the best of the best. We are proud to announce Pasco County's 2020 Star Team, Star Performer, and Star Leader of the Year.
Faced with the nation's biggest health challenge in more than 100 years, many in our community lost jobs and quickly ran out of money to pay bills and buy basic necessities. The Federal Coronavirus Aid, Relief, and Economic Security Act, or CARES, provided millions of dollars in relief to Pasco County citizens. But ensuring that money was distributed to the people who needed it most took a small army of Pasco County team members from several departments. The Pasco Community Cares team tackled this monumental
task, creating program guidelines and a user-friendly application process, ensuring the right technology was in place, crafting messaging to accurately inform our community, and addressing hundreds of customer questions and concerns. It was a truly collaborative effort, with both individuals and teams adapting and evolving with each round of the CARES program throughout the year, providing service excellence at the highest level. The Pasco Community Cares team serves several thousand people, paying out over $4 million in much-needed
aid with compassion, respect, and integrity.
With the advent of COVID-19, the Pasco County team had to quickly adjust to restricted office work conditions, with many working remotely for the first time. The demand for online collaboration and meetings soared, and with that, the need for information technology support and training on the available products offered to the enterprise. Todd Kersey, who heads up the support in day-to-day operations for our telecommunications team, took on the challenge of implementing the necessary online collaboration and meeting tools. Todd tirelessly
provided the necessary support and training across the organization as we successfully transitioned to a remote work model. Additionally, Todd devoted a significant amount of time assisting teams across the organization with hosting their WebEx meetings, including board meetings, team leadership meetings, and Citizen Academy meetings. This volume of work included more than 75 meetings and over 200 hours of individual support time. Through all of this, he continued to receive glowing comments from
his customers for the support he provided. Todd Kersey is a clear choice for Star Performer of the Year.
It started with a clear vision. Create Pasco County's own newsroom. Tambri Lane has made this her mission, each step of the way, transforming a fledgling public communications function into the Media Relations and Communications Department. Small but mighty is how she describes this team of five that has quickly become one of the most trusted and effective government communication resources in the Tampa Bay area. In 2020 alone, Media Relations handled more than 1,000 media contacts and produced more than 100 videos. They've helped Pasco County's
social media following grow by nearly 50% since 2017. Tambry's commitment to service excellence guides this growth. And it's no accident that Pasco County is often the first call local reporters make when they need a subject matter expert or an input on a regional issue. Now more than ever, Pasco County's stories are being told in a way that highlights our team members' dedication and bright future. In 2020, Tambri challenged her team to innovate in the face of the pandemic. Resulting in hybrid virtual event
videos that ensure groundbreakings,
New facilities. and team updates were not lost to social distancing. Virtual interviews and ready-made packages helped keep our media partners informed. Tambry quickly jumped in to assist with cares-related initiatives beyond program messaging, helping shape SOPs and an online experience to better serve our customers in their time of need. Being Pasco County's newsroom means telling our stories, and Media Relations strives to highlight the exceptional work of our team members and departments
in each branch. Whether it's the County Administrator's Podcast or An HR benefits video Census support messaging. An exciting new sports campus or infrastructure project to improve our communities, we're ready to help you shine. We're much more than just news releases, and we're continuously analyzing our outreach and strategies for an improved customer experience that maximizes limited resources. We look forward to a future of growth, innovation, and potential with her leadership.

So thank you. Okay, a resolution by the Board of County
Commissioners of Pasco County, Florida, commending the twenty twenty Star Performers of the Year. Whereas each year one employee, one leader, and one team of employees of Pasco County is named Star Performers of the Year and are recognized for their their accomplishments. And whereas Todd Kirsty has been selected to receive the 2020 Star Performer of the Year Award, Tambri Lane has been selected to receive the 2020 Star Leader of the Year Award and the Community Cares Act implementation team of more than 80 individuals
from nine different departments, including the clerk's office here represented by their team leaders, Brian Hoban, Manny Long, Lisa Sdanett. Danielle Bierman, Jessica Blesser, Marcy Esberg, Tambri Lane, Christina McGonagall, and Samantha Grant have been selected to receive the 2020 Star Team of the Year Award. And whereas in order for an organization to become Premier, it must attract, grow, and support a workforce of servant leaders that are dedicated
to improving the lives of people, contributing to a purpose larger than their individual job, and performing at the highest possible level day in and day out out. And whereas those these 2020 award recipients consistently demonstrate our core values with an impeccable work ethic, dedication to service, excellence, and achieving quality outcomes in every situation. They serve as an example to their fellow team members of going above and beyond and exemplify the expectations of the Star Performer
of the Year. Now therefore be it resolved by the Board of County Commissioners of Pasco County, Florida, that said Board hereby congratulates our twenty twenty Star Performers of the Year for Pasco County and comm commends them for their outstanding efforts in supporting the County's journey to premiere. Done and resolved with a quorum present and voting this twenty sixth day of january twenty twenty one.
